About the role
Checkr recently acquired Truework, a company focused on providing employment and income verification for various needs like mortgage loans and background checks. Truework operates as an independent unit within Checkr, combining startup agility with the resources of a larger organization. This role involves delivering high-quality, empathetic support to a diverse customer base across multiple communication channels.

What you'll do
- Provide outstanding customer assistance through phone, email, and chat, maintaining professionalism and clarity.
- Resolve complex technical and procedural problems quickly and accurately, escalating issues when necessary.
- Manage a large volume of incoming inquiries, prioritizing effectively and paying close attention to detail.
- Conduct proactive follow-ups to prevent recurring issues and improve overall customer satisfaction.
- Contribute to knowledge base content and process improvements by identifying common support trends.
- Work with product, operations, and engineering teams to share feedback and enhance the customer experience.
Requirements
- At least 1 year of customer support experience in a high-volume setting, such as a contact center, SaaS company, or startup.
- Excellent verbal and written communication skills, including strong active listening and comprehension.
- Proven ability to troubleshoot software and hardware issues using various tools and platforms.
- High proficiency in multitasking and working across multiple systems simultaneously without sacrificing accuracy.
- Demonstrated resilience, self-management, and a commitment to continuous learning.
- A proactive mindset with a focus on action, urgency, and ownership to achieve significant results.
Practical notes
Checkr offers a learning and development allowance, competitive cash and equity compensation, and opportunities for advancement. Benefits include 100% medical, dental, and vision coverage, up to $25K reimbursement for fertility, adoption, and parental planning services, flexible PTO, and a monthly wellness stipend. This role requires working from the Nashville office 3 or more days a week. In-office perks include daily lunch, a commuter stipend, and snacks. A relocation stipend may be available for those moving to a Checkr hub location.
